Output 96b490230059a6e3ba3d34de26c2fdded35ea9e57319ad4eaa06f9b5fb15062a:22

value
12675885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e0d3b04c95fde33b0777a651c95f482cbb88309 OP_EQUAL
address
3DBWuzHirmwMh4AeZ8ZSzaqicXTdNotbAd
transaction
96b490230059a6e3ba3d34de26c2fdded35ea9e57319ad4eaa06f9b5fb15062a
spent
true